Transaction 59485e103411262954e34d92b3ee976362c093aa63a393ddc389f1c239d986ef
1 Input
1 Output
-
59485e103411262954e34d92b3ee976362c093aa63a393ddc389f1c239d986ef:0
- value
- 159094
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56830439ec2f908cfa85bb9b8856cf1dd7225c34 OP_EQUAL
- address
- 39aSzEAYnYnKniaUjhdvfowy5MNgWZ8Gvq